This specimen was lot 30708 in Heritage sale 3081 (New York, January 2020), where it sold for $1,560. The catalog description[1] noted, "Germany: Weimar Republic Proof 3 Mark 1932-D PR66 Cameo NGC, Munich mint. A sensational gem displaying pale undertones of burgundy over fields yielding a distinctive and delightful shimmer, unbroken by any important instances of handling. The finest of the type seen by NGC to also be awarded a "Cameo" designation." This type was minted in large quantities 1931-33 but the SCWC notes that less than 10% of the issue was released. It is now scarce. The Goethe commemorative (KM 76), issued at the same time, is quite a bit more available.

Recorded mintage: 1,986,000.

Specification: 15 g, 0.500 fine silver, 30 mm diameter.

Catalog reference: KM 74, J-349.
